Date updated: Thursday 18th December 2025

The Employment Rights Bill has now received Royal Assent and is officially the Employment Rights Act 2025. This follows the House of Lords relenting during the final stages of parliamentary “ping-pong” earlier this week.

Coming into effect immediately is the repeal of the Strikes (Minimum Service Levels) Act 2023, which is a change aimed at reshaping the balance between industrial action and public service continuity.

In the New Year, we are expecting further updates, including consultations and an impact assessment, on the planned removal of the cap on unfair dismissal compensation.
